Overview Hike 30 mg/20 mg Capsule
G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D, or acid reflux) is effectively managed with the dual-action formulation, Hike 30mg/20mg capsules. This combination medication alleviates common GERD symptoms, including heartburn, stomach upset, and irritation, by neutralizing stomach acid and facilitating gas expulsion for improved comfort. Administer Hike 30mg/20mg capsules on an empty stomach, following your physician's prescribed dosage and duration. Treatment length is determined by your individual response and overall condition; premature discontinuation may lead to symptom recurrence and disease exacerbation. Comprehensive disclosure of all other medications to your healthcare provider is crucial, as interactions are possible. While diarrhea, abdominal pain, dry mouth, headache, gas, and fatigue are commonly reported, these side effects are often transient. Report any concerning side effects promptly to your doctor. Drowsiness and dizziness are potential effects; therefore, avoid driving or activities requiring alertness until the medicine's impact is known. Alcohol consumption should be avoided due to potential additive drowsiness. Lifestyle changes, such as consuming cool milk and omitting hot beverages, spicy foods, and chocolate, may enhance treatment efficacy. Prior to initiating treatment, inform your doctor of any existing kidney or liver conditions, as well as pregnancy, pregnancy planning, or breastfeeding.

How Hike 30 mg/20 mg Capsule works:
Hike 30 mg/20 mg capsules contain Domperidone and Rabeprazole, two medications working synergistically. Domperidone, a prokinetic agent, enhances gastrointestinal motility, facilitating smoother food passage through the stomach. Rabeprazole, a proton pump inhibitor (PPI), lowers stomach acid production, providing relief from acid indigestion and heartburn symptoms.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CAUTION
Use of alcohol with Hike 30 mg/20 mg Capsules should be approached with care. Seek medical advice before combining them.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Hike 30 mg/20 mg Capsules during pregnancy may pose ris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ible dangers pr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Administration of Hike 30 mg/20 mg capsules while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ates potential drug transfer to breast milk, posing a ris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king a Hike 30 mg/20 mg Capsule might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, or cause drowsiness and dizziness. Driving is inadvisable if these effects are experienced.
KidneyCAUTION
Individuals with kidney impairment should exercise caution when using Hike 30 mg/20 mg Capsules. D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is recommended.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should use Hike 30 mg/20 mg capsules c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consultation with a physician is advised. Hike 30 mg/20 mg capsules are contraindicated in individuals with moderate to severe hepatic dysfunction.
